In their own words

I've owned this car for just over 5 years now. Got it with 28000 on the clock, now at just over 56000. Although it has never broken down, it has had minor niggly issues that I've never had with any other car, that have needed garage attention. So it has been a minor annoyance having to visit the local garage more often than I would like. So not the bulletproof reliability I would have expected from Hyundai. Plus sides is it is reasonably quiet although road noise can be an issue on some surfaces, and it is spacious inside and has the driving feel of a much larger car. I also find it a comfortable car to drive on longer motorway journeys.

How reliable do you find the car?

Annoying niggly issues and minor problems. Bonnet catch jammed, now on 3rd aircon unit since new. Drop link and suspension issues, window washer pump failure due to leaking. And now getting intermittent hard brake pedal or resistance when braking. The car has never broken down, but just feels its been in the garage more often than i would like

Does the car do everything you expected it to do?

Comfortable enough and reasonably quiet and economical
